About Agustinus Bandur

Agustinus Bandur is a scholar working on Management of Technology and Innovation, Human Factors and Ergonomics and Research and Theory, having authored 58 papers that have together received 342 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Entrepreneurship Studies and Influences (7 papers), School Leadership and Teacher Performance (7 papers) and SMEs Development and Digital Marketing (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in General Decision Sciences (17 citations), Management of Technology and Innovation (47 citations) and Education (176 citations). Agustinus Bandur has collaborated with scholars based in Indonesia, France and Malaysia. Frequent co-authors include Jatmiko Jatmiko, Asnan Furinto, Mohammad Hamsal, Firdaus Alamsjah, Tirta Nugraha Mursitama, David Gamage, Olivier L’Haridon, Ferdinand M. Vieider, Lubomír Cingl and Amit Kothiyal.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, IEEE Access and The Review of Economics and Statistics.
